GENERAL INFORMATION
General
These are the mounting instructions for the Novy hood shown on the cover. The manual is a separate booklet that has been supplied with this hood. Read these instructions carefully before installing and commissioning the hood. It is recommended to have one or more qualified persons carry out the installation.
Carefully take the hood from the packaging. Check if all mounting materials have been supplied using the drawings on page 2.
The hood is to be used above a hob and/or domino and intended for household use only.
Important before mounting
Page 2 of these mounting instructions show the mounting drawings. Observe the following mounting tips before starting the mounting activities:
• For easier mounting of the telescopic hood it is recommended to do this with at least 2 persons.
• Check if all mounting materials have been supplied using the drawings on page 2.
• Position the wall socket such that it is near the hood.
Exhaust or recirculation
Before starting any mounting activities, you must have made the choice if you are going to make an exhaust duct to the outside or if you are going to use the hood as a recirculation hood. In case of an exhaust duct to the outside, carefully read the section in these mounting instructions for installing the exhaust duct. For recirculation, please separately order the recirculation kit.
INSTALLATION
Proceed following the mounting drawings on page 2.
PAY ATTENTION TO THE FRONT AND REAR SIDES OF THE COOKER HOOD. The glass adjustable flap opens forwards. The lighting is installed on the rear. Carefully look at the mounting drawings!
1
Preparations for mounting
The model 680 is intended for integration into a cabinet of 60 cm wide and the model 686 is for integration into a
cabinet of 90 cm wide.
The recommended mounting height for an electrical or ceramic cooking plate is min. 600 mm and max. 750 mm. The
mounting height for a gas or induction cooking plate is min. 650 mm and max. 750 mm.
Make a cut-out:
• Type 680: 505 mm x 265 mm.
• Type 686: 805 mm x 265 mm.
• Place the cooker hood as far as possible forward, at least 16 mm.
• The cooker hood is to be mounted in a kitchen cabinet (plate thickness at least 16 mm and maximum 35 mm).
• Make sure there is a socket near the hood. It must be possible at all times to remove the power supply from the cooker hood.
• Make sure the cabinet door is not lower than the bottom of the cooker hood.
2
Changing the exhaust direction of the motor (top/ rear)
• Change the position of the motor cover before installing the cooker hood.
• Loosen the 8 screws from the motor cover.
• Rotate the motor cover a quarter turn.
• Screw the motor cover back on.
3
Installing the cooker hood in the cabinet
• Install the cooker hood in such a way that the operating controls are to the right of the user.
• Next, push the cooker hood upward into the recess by the edges until you hear a firm click.
4
Mounting the cooker hood
• Connect the exhaust duct to the motor outlet by means of a hose clamp or aluminum tape.
• Put the plug into the wall socket.
• Open the rotating valve and hand-tighten the 4 clamping screws. Take care not to over-tighten the screws. Close the rotating valve.
Page 4
EN 10
5
Finishing of the hood
• When necessary you can fortify the front of cabinet. Make sure the hood is well aligned with the lower part of the cabinet.
Install the exhaust duct
The motor outlet has a diameter of 150 mm. It is recommended to connect an exhaust duct with a diameter of 150 mm to this. A reducer is supplied with the hood. Only mount the reducer when using an exhaust duct with a diameter of 125 mm.
For optimum performance of the hood it is important to pay attention to the following points.
Circular ducts:
• Use smooth, non-flammable pipes with an internal diameter that is equal to the external diameter of the connection­nozzle of the hood. Maximally extend flexible ducts and cut them to size.
• Do not reduce the exhaust diameter. This will lower the capacity and raise the noise level.
• When connecting to a short exhaust duct, it may be required to mount a non-return valve in the duct to avoid wind­blowing in.
• Use a hose clamp or aluminum tape for airtight connections.
• In case of an exhaust pipe through the wall, use a wall vent.
Flat duct:
• Use flat duct with rounded corners and with air deflectors. Available at Novy.
General information:
• Make the duct as short as possible and with as few as possible bends to the outside.
• Avoid square bends. Use rounded bends for proper air conduction.
• In case of an exhaust pipe through the outside wall passing a cavity wall, make sure that the exhaust duct fully bridges the cavity and slightly declines to the outside.
• In case of an exhaust pipe through the roof, use a double-walled roof passage with sufficient width.
• Never connect to a flue duct.
• Make sure that sufficient air is supplied. Fresh air can be supplied by slightly opening a window or an outside door or by installing an inlet grate.
ACCESSORIES
Recirculation
In case of recirculation Novy provides charcoal filters. The manual supplied with the recirculation kit includes the mounting and user instructions.
